Understanding Dyslexia and Auditory Processing



Dyslexia affects roughly 1 in 5 people, making it among one of the most typical learning disabilities. If you're browsing dyslexia, you could find that it doesn't simply influence reading and writing; it can likewise impact how you process auditory information.

Acoustic handling refers to exactly how your brain interprets sounds, including language. When you struggle with this, it can result in difficulties in understanding talked directions and adhering to discussions.

You may observe that you often misinterpret what you hear or that it takes much longer for you to react in conversations. This isn't a representation of your knowledge; it's a specific trouble pertaining to refining acoustic signals.

Comprehending this connection is essential since it aids make clear why you may excel in visual jobs while encountering hurdles in tasks that depend on auditory understanding.

Creating Encouraging Learning Environments



Developing an encouraging discovering setting is crucial for assisting individuals with acoustic handling difficulties are successful. Start by lessening distractions in your classroom or learning space. Use acoustic panels or soft home furnishings to absorb noise, which can aid trainees focus better. Ensure seating setups allow for clear sightlines to the educator and any kind of aesthetic help.



Next, integrate clear and succinct interaction. Speak gradually and utilize straightforward language, looking for understanding frequently. Urge students to ask questions if they're unsure. Visual aids like charts, representations, and composed instructions can enhance understanding and retention.

Additionally, promote a society of perseverance and understanding amongst peers. Teach trainees about acoustic processing problems, advertising empathy and assistance. Team tasks can be beneficial; simply guarantee that functions are clear which pupils collaborate to support each other.

Lastly, provide regular comments. Commemorate progress and achievements, despite exactly how small. This motivation develops self-confidence and strengthens the idea that knowing is a trip.
